 Use of Photoswitchable PAD inhibitor


Photoswitchable PAD inhibitor is a photoactivated protein arginine deiminase (PAD) inhibitor and a derivative of BB-Cl-amidine that contains an azobenzene photoswitch allowing optical control of PAD activity. Without photoactivation, it is a weak inhibitor of PAD2 and is less potent than BB-Cl-amidine in inhibiting citrulline production in vitro. It does not inhibit histone H3 citrullination in HEK293T cells overexpressing PAD2. However, it can rapidly be photoactivated with UV-A radiation to the more active cis-isomer, which is an irreversible, competitive inhibitor of histone H3 citrullination.
